How they compare
Cambodia currently reports 19.2% against 18.0% in Romania, a difference of 1.2%.
That makes Cambodia's figure about 1.1 times Romania's.
Across all 26 years both countries report, Cambodia has been ahead every year.
Cambodia ranks 53rd and Romania ranks 56th of 206 countries.
Cambodia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cambodia | Romania |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 21.5% | 11.5% | 10.0% | Cambodia |
| 2010s | 19.9% | 9.4% | 10.5% | Cambodia |
| 2020s | 19.1% | 15.1% | 4.0% | Cambodia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
